Phyllosticta leaf spot
Phyllosticta fallopiae
Description
The causative agent of this disease is the fungus Phyllosticta fallopiae, a member of the Phyllostictaceae family. It is a specialized pathogen known for infecting species of the Fallopia genus, causing significant leaf spot symptoms that may lead to defoliation if left uncontrolled.
The disease primarily targets plants such as Japanese knotweed (Fallopia japonica) and related species. These plants are often susceptible to various fungal pathogens, but Phyllosticta fallopiae is particularly noted for its ability to thrive in dense canopy environments where air circulation is restricted.
Symptoms appear as distinct spots on the leaf blades. These lesions are typically necrotic, with light brown centers and darker margins. As the disease progresses, small black fruiting bodies known as pycnidia develop within the dead tissue. These structures release spores that spread the infection to healthy parts of the plant and neighboring foliage.
Environmental conditions play a crucial role in disease progression. High humidity, prolonged periods of leaf wetness, and temperatures between 20°C and 25°C favor the rapid germination of spores. The pathogen overwinters in crop debris, specifically in fallen leaves, which serve as the primary inoculum source for the following growing season.
Effective management strategies focus on sanitation and environmental modification. Reducing plant density to improve airflow and minimizing overhead watering can significantly lower infection rates. In severe cases, the application of fungicides may be necessary to protect the plant's health, though meticulous removal of infected plant debris remains the most essential preventative measure.
